The brown parrotbill is a parrotbill found in the central and eastern Himalayas. It has earlier been called a brown suthora. This is a 17–19 cm long grey brown bird with a long tail and a characteristic small yellowish parrot-like bill. A dark stripe runs above the eyes and along the sides of the crown. They move in small groups and will sometimes join mixed species foraging flocks. It is found in Bhutan, China, India, Myanmar, and Nepal. It is classified as least concern by IUCN.
